Torben is the Danish derivative of the Norwegian Torbjörn and means Tor’s (Thor) bear. Tor is the god of thunder in Norse mythology. When we named Torben we wanted a Norwegian name, but also wanted something pronounceable by English speakers. Abigail is Hebrew in origin and means "father rejoiced" or "father's joy".
